Setup
Mounting:
The fixture can be mounted on a flat surface or suspended using the included Omega brackets. Ensure the mounting location is stable and can safely support the fixture's weight (approximately 16.37 lbs).
- Attach the Omega brackets to the bottom of the fixture using the provided screws.
- Securely fasten the brackets to a truss or other suitable mounting structure.
- Always use a safety cable (not included) as a secondary attachment for overhead installations.
Power Connection:
Connect the provided power cable to the "POWER IN" port on the rear of the fixture and then to a compatible AC110-240V, 50/60Hz power outlet. The fixture has a "POWER OUT" port for daisy-chaining power to other compatible units.
DMX Connection (Optional):
For DMX control, connect a DMX controller to the "DMX IN" port using the provided DMX cable. If connecting multiple fixtures, link them in a daisy-chain configuration from "DMX OUT" of the first fixture to "DMX IN" of the next. Terminate the last fixture in the chain with a DMX terminator (not included) for optimal signal integrity.
Operation
The DJXFLI 8-Eye LED Moving Head Light offers four primary control modes, accessible via the LCD display and buttons on the rear panel.

Figure 3: Visual representation of the four control modes.
Control Panel:
The control panel features an LCD display and four buttons: MENU, UP, DOWN, and ENTER. Use these buttons to navigate through the menu and select desired settings.

Figure 4: Product specification diagram including control panel details.
1. Auto Mode:
In Auto mode, the fixture runs through pre-programmed light shows automatically. This mode is ideal for quick setup without external control.
- Press the MENU button until "Auto" appears on the display.
- Use UP/DOWN to select different auto programs if available.
- Press ENTER to confirm the selection.
2. Sound Active Mode:
The fixture reacts to ambient sound or music, creating dynamic light patterns synchronized with the audio. A built-in microphone detects sound.
- Press the MENU button until "Sound" appears on the display.
- Use UP/DOWN to adjust sound sensitivity if available.
- Press ENTER to confirm.
3. Master/Slave Mode:
This mode allows multiple fixtures to operate in synchronization without a DMX controller. One fixture acts as the "Master" and controls all "Slave" fixtures.
- Master Setup: Select "Master" mode on one fixture via the menu.
- Slave Setup: On all other fixtures, select "Slave" mode.
- Connect the DMX OUT of the Master unit to the DMX IN of the first Slave unit, and continue daisy-chaining.
4. DMX512 Mode:
For advanced control, connect the fixture to a DMX512 controller. This allows precise control over each parameter (color, movement, strobe, dimmer) using DMX channels.
- Set the DMX address for each fixture using the control panel. Ensure each fixture has a unique starting address.
- Select the desired DMX channel mode (9 or 38 channels) on the fixture.
- Refer to the DMX Channel Table in the Specifications section for detailed channel assignments.

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your fixture, refer to the following common problems and solutions:
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| No power | Power cable disconnected, faulty outlet, blown fuse. | Check power connections. Test the outlet. Replace the fuse if blown (located near the power input). |
| No light output | Dimmer at 0%, incorrect mode, DMX signal issue. | Increase dimmer setting. Select Auto or Sound Active mode. Check DMX connections and address. |
| Fixture not responding to DMX | Incorrect DMX address, faulty DMX cable, DMX terminator missing. | Verify DMX address. Test DMX cable. Ensure DMX terminator is used on the last fixture. |
| Erratic movement or colors | Interference, DMX signal issues, internal fault. | Check DMX connections. Ensure proper grounding. If problem persists, contact support. |
